这是一篇发布在预印本网站Preprints上的论文,基本信息如下

英文标题:Micro-Nonuniformity and Single-Molecule Mixture Science: An Introduction

摘要:Micro-nonuniformity, as a fundamental natural property, is widespread across a range 

of microscopic systems, such as polymer systems, biomacromolecular systems, and nanosystems; 

however, the construction of micro-nonuniform molecular systems has not yet been realized at the

 level of organic molecules with well-defined structural compositions. Inspired by the "chemical space"

 concept, I recently reported a study of the single-molecule mixture state; in this paper, I provide a 

detailed discussion of micro-nonuniformity and the concept of a "single-molecule mixture".

微不均一性作为一种基本的自然属性,广泛存在于各种微观系统中,例如聚合物系统、生物大分子系统和

纳米系统;然而,在具有明确结构组成的有机分子层面,尚未实现微不均一分子系统的构建。受“化学空间”

概念的启发,我近期发表了一项关于单分子混合态的研究;本文将对微不均匀性及“单分子混合物”的概念

进行详细探讨。

Keywords: single-molecule mixture; micro-nonuniformity; micro-nonuniform synthesis; 

chemical modification of polysaccharides

关键词:单分子混合物;微不均一性;微不均一性合成;多糖的化学修饰
